In today’s digital age, data analytics has become a critical component for informed decision-making across a wide range of industries. While quantitative data analysis has traditionally been dominant, interior designers service email list qualitative analysis also plays a crucial role in providing deeper insights into subjective and unstructured aspects of data. Unlike quantitative analysis, which focuses on quantity and numerical measures, qualitative analysis focuses on understanding the meaning and context of data, exploring patterns, perceptions, and behaviors. However, qualitative analysis has historically been more laborious and subjective. This is where artificial intelligence (AI) is beginning to make a difference, transforming the way this type of analysis is approached.

The Challenge of Qualitative Analysis
Qualitative analysis involves interpreting non-numerical data, such as text, images, or audio, to identify patterns, trends, and meaning. This process often requires complex human skills, such as contextual understanding, expert knowledge, and inference ability. However, these processes can be subjective and prone to bias, as well as being time- and resource-intensive.

AI as an Enabler of Qualitative Analysis
AI is fundamentally changing the way we approach qualitative data analysis by offering advanced natural language processing ( NLP ), computer vision, and audio analysis capabilities. These technologies enable machines to understand and process unstructured data in a similar way to how a human would, but at a much larger scale and at a faster speed.

Applications of AI in Qualitative Analysis
Sentiment Analysis : AI can analyze large amounts of text, such as product reviews or social media comments, to determine overall user sentiment toward a brand, product, or service.
Topic Extraction : Using NLP techniques, AI can automatically identify key topics within large text data sets, allowing researchers to focus on specific areas of interest.
Pattern Recognition in Images : Computer vision enables AI systems to identify objects, faces, emotions, and other visual elements in images, which can be useful in fields such as medicine, security, and manufacturing.
Audio Sentiment Analysis : AI can analyze tone and emotions in audio recordings, which can be useful in detecting emotions in customer service calls or assessing customer satisfaction.
